Material Selection: The Foundation of Quality

The journey of crafting exceptional drumsticks begins with the careful selection of raw materials. At EcoStix, we primarily use high-grade woods such as maple, hickory, and oak, each chosen for their unique properties that influence the drumsticks’ performance.

  • Maple: Known for its lightweight nature, maple offers a faster playing experience and is ideal for genres requiring quick, delicate strokes.

  • Hickory: A popular choice among drummers, hickory provides a balanced feel with excellent shock absorption, making it suitable for a wide range of musical styles.

  • Oak: Denser and heavier, oak drumsticks offer enhanced durability and power, perfect for drummers who prefer a solid, robust feel.

Drying and Conditioning: Preparing the Wood

Once the wood is selected, it undergoes a drying process to reduce moisture content, preventing future warping or cracking. This step is crucial in ensuring the longevity and stability of the drumsticks. The wood is carefully conditioned to achieve the optimal balance between flexibility and strength.

Shaping the Drumsticks: Precision and Consistency

The dried wood blanks are then machined into the rough shape of drumsticks. Using precision lathes, each piece is turned to achieve the desired length and diameter, adhering to strict tolerances to maintain consistency across all products. Sanding and Smoothing: The Perfect Finish

After shaping, the drumsticks undergo a thorough sanding process to remove any imperfections and achieve a smooth surface. Multiple grades of sandpaper are used, progressing from coarse to fine, ensuring a comfortable grip and an aesthetically pleasing finish. This meticulous attention to detail enhances both the feel and appearance of the drumsticks.
